-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/55702/
-----------------------------------------------------------

(Updated 一月 19, 2017, 2:13 p.m.)


Review request for ranger, Don Bosco Durai, Colm O hEigeartaigh, Ramesh Mani, 
Selvamohan Neethiraj, and Velmurugan Periasamy.


Bugs: RANGER-1317
    https://issues.apache.org/jira/browse/RANGER-1317


Repository: ranger


Description
-------

There are two defects in install scripts for ranger usersync process:
1. The rangerBaseDirName variable equals to /etc/ranger when we install the 
ranger usersync process. So the usersync can only be installed in /etc/ranger. 
As a result, the installer can't plan the installation path according to their 
needs.In some system environment, it is not reasonable. 
There is a configuration attribute to resolve the issue in ranger-admin. 
Similarly, the install scripts for ranger usersync process should also provide 
configuration attributes to solve this issue.
2. The usersyncBaseDirName variable equals to usersync. The install program 
uses following code to create directorys.
dirList = [ rangerBaseDirName, usersyncBaseDirName, confFolderName, 
certFolderName ]
In above list other variables are absolute value of the path, but 
usersyncBaseDirName is not. Above list should be modified as following:
dirList = [ rangerBaseDirName, usersyncBaseDirFullName, confFolderName, 
certFolderName ]
The following code should be modified also.
fixPermList = [ ".", usersyncBaseDirName, confFolderName, certFolderName ]


Diffs (updated)
-----

  unixauthservice/scripts/install.properties e784dda 
  unixauthservice/scripts/setup.py 673a48f 

Diff: https://reviews.apache.org/r/55702/diff/


Testing
-------


Thanks,

Qiang Zhang

Reply via email to